Why Energy Upgrade Myths Persist

Energy efficiency improvements are one of the most talked-about home investments — and one of the most misunderstood. Homeowners are regularly exposed to marketing claims, neighbor anecdotes, and half-remembered advice that sound authoritative but often don't hold up under scrutiny. The stakes are real: acting on faulty assumptions can mean spending thousands on upgrades that deliver modest results while overlooking cheaper fixes that would have made a bigger difference.

Cutting through that noise starts with examining the claims head-on. Below, we address the most common myths that steer homeowners in the wrong direction — and explain what the evidence actually suggests.

Myth

Replacing windows is the single best thing you can do to cut energy bills.

Fact

Air sealing gaps and improving insulation typically deliver a better return on investment than window replacement alone.

Windows get a lot of attention, and double-pane or triple-pane glass does reduce heat transfer compared to older single-pane units. However, the U.S. Department of Energy has noted that air leaks — around window frames, door thresholds, electrical outlets, and attic hatches — are often responsible for a large share of a home's energy loss. Sealing those gaps with caulk or weatherstripping costs a fraction of new windows and frequently addresses the same underlying problem. Window replacement can be worthwhile, especially for very old, degraded units, but it rarely tops the priority list when air sealing hasn't been addressed first.

Myth

Insulation always pays for itself quickly — within a year or two.

Fact

Payback timelines for insulation vary widely and depend on your climate, existing insulation levels, energy prices, and the type of insulation installed.

Insulation can be an excellent investment, but broad claims about rapid payback should be treated with caution. In a cold climate with high heating costs and an under-insulated attic, payback in a few years is plausible. In a mild climate with moderate energy prices, the timeline may stretch considerably longer. The Department of Energy recommends adding insulation up to the R-value appropriate for your climate zone — going beyond that threshold yields diminishing returns. A professional energy assessment or an online energy audit tool can give you a much more grounded estimate for your specific situation.

Myth

Turning the heat or AC completely off when you leave saves more energy than a programmable thermostat.

Fact

Allowing your HVAC system to recover to a comfortable temperature after being off can sometimes consume more energy than a moderate setback.

The logic seems intuitive: if no one's home, why run the system? But in extreme weather, a home allowed to drift very far from a set point requires the HVAC system to work harder to recover, which can negate the savings. Programmable or smart thermostats are designed to manage setbacks intelligently — reducing conditioning during away hours without forcing aggressive recovery cycles. The energy savings from a well-programmed setback thermostat are well-documented, though the exact amount varies by home size, insulation quality, and climate.

Myth

LED bulbs don't make a meaningful difference in your energy bill.

Fact

LED lighting uses significantly less electricity than incandescent bulbs and can contribute meaningfully to overall household energy reduction.

LED bulbs use roughly 75% less energy than traditional incandescent bulbs and last substantially longer, according to the Department of Energy. For households where lighting accounts for a notable share of electricity use — especially those with many fixtures or lights left on for long hours — the cumulative effect across a full year is real. LEDs aren't a silver bullet for a high energy bill, but dismissing them as trivial undersells a low-cost, low-effort upgrade that delivers consistent results over time.

Myth

Once you make energy upgrades, your savings are guaranteed.

Fact

Actual savings depend on occupant behavior, local energy prices, and how the home is used — results vary and are never guaranteed.

Energy upgrades change the efficiency envelope of your home, but how the home is operated still matters enormously. A well-insulated house with triple-pane windows where windows are left open during heating season or where thermostats are kept at extreme settings will not perform as projected. Additionally, energy prices fluctuate, which affects the dollar value of any efficiency gain. Think of upgrades as reducing the energy required to maintain comfort — not as an automatic fixed saving independent of how you live in the space.

Making Smart Decisions About Energy Upgrades

Understanding what energy upgrades can and cannot do is only half the battle. The other half is applying that knowledge strategically to your specific home. A drafty 1950s bungalow has different priorities than a 1990s ranch with good windows but an undersized attic. Start with a home energy audit — many utility companies offer them at low or no cost — to identify where your home is actually losing conditioned air or wasting energy.

From there, prioritize upgrades with the shortest payback period for your situation. Air sealing and weatherstripping are often the first recommendation because they're inexpensive and broadly effective. Verify Incentives Before Budgeting

Federal tax credits and state or utility rebates for energy-efficient upgrades can be substantial, but eligibility requirements, income limits, and eligible equipment categories change. Never build a renovation budget that depends on a rebate or credit without first confirming current terms through official government or utility sources. What applied last year may not apply today.
